@charset "utf-8";

/*video*/
#video{width:658px;height:398px;margin:0 auto; background-color:#000;}


div#new_list{width:658px; margin:0 5px;}
div#new_list ul{width:658px; overflow:hidden;}
div#new_list ul li{float:left; width:319px; padding:5px;}
div#new_list ul li h3{display:block;height:20px; margin-top:15px; text-indent:-9999px;}


li#list_info h3{ background:url(/images/common/txt_nc_righth3_pt00_01.gif) no-repeat 0 0;}
li#list_photo h3{ background:url(/images/common/txt_nc_righth3_pt00_02.gif) no-repeat 0 0;}

/**/
dl.ph_list{width:319px; overflow:hidden; height:110px;}
dl.ph_list dt{width:129px; float:left;}
dl.ph_list dd{width:190px; float:left;line-height:1.5em;}


dl.ph_list dd p{line-height:1.5em;}

dl.ph_list dt img{border:1px solid #d1d1d1; padding:1px;}

dl.ph_list dd h4{font-weight:bold; margin-bottom:5px;}

/*詳細はこちらボタン*/
dl.ph_list dd a.btn_detail{
display:block;height:22px;
float:right;
background:url(/images/common/ic_listbtn_01.gif) no-repeat 0 50%;
text-indent:25px;}
dl.ph_list dd a.btn_detail b{
display:block;
margin-top:5px;
font-size:11px;}
dl.ph_list dd h4 a{text-decoration:underline;}
#news_column div.nc_right div#pglist02{margin:13px auto 25px 50px;}


